About this job
Overview:
The Cone Production Maintenance Technician is responsible for ensuring the smooth and efficient operation of machinery and equipment in the production facility. The role involved performing routine maintenance, troubleshooting mechanical issues, implementing repairs to minimize downtime and optimize productivity. The technician will work closely with the production team to support ongoing operations and ensure compliance with safety and quality standards.
Responsibilities:- Support, installation, rebuild and maintenance of all production equipment such as baking ovens, conveyor systems, and a variety of packaging and support equipment.
- Evaluate and recommend improvements for efficiency, capability, and yield
- Performs mechanical skills, but not limited to, mechanical, electrical, pneumatic and hydraulic troubleshooting and repair of machinery
- Perform routine preventative maintenance per a set schedule as well as respond to unscheduled repairs in a safe and timely manner.
- Prepare and set up machinery for scheduled production runs.
- Troubleshoot and diagnose equipment problems
- Read and interpret equipment manuals and work orders.
- Perform other duties as directed by supervisor
- This position involves regular bending, stooping, twisting, and lifting.
- Must maintain a high degree of forklift operation skills
- Must be able to regularly; lift up to 75lbs, have full use of arms and legs and climb stairs to access all areas of the plant and offices.
- Required to stand on their feet and/ or walk up to 12 hours per day.
- Must be able to detect audible tones and alarms
- Frequently communicate with coworkers in long and short distances
